Target Group: Year 4 (Sk Jalan Ong Tiang Swee)

Subject: English Language


Date: 11th February 2015
Class: Year 4C
Time: 8.15am – 9.15am (1 hour)
Level Proficiency: Intermediate
Focused skill: Writing
Integrated skill: Listening and speaking, grammar
Language focus: Spelling
Previous 1. Pupils know about spending money
knowledge: 2. Pupils know how to create a sentence
Unit: 2
Theme: World of Knowledge
Topic: Spending Wisely
Content 3.2 By the end of the 6 year primary schooling, pupils will be able to write using appropriate language, form
Standards: and style for a range of purposes.
Learning 3.2.2
Standards: Able to write with guidance:
(a) labels
(b) notices
(c) messages
Objectives: By the end of the lesson, pupils will be able to:
1. Spell the words correctly.
2. Create a simple sentence.
Teaching Aids: 1. Textbook
Educational Multiple intelligent, thinking skills
Emphasis:
Moral values: Respectful, cooperation, and sharing and moderation.
Sources: Textbook
